IDF (intermediate distribution frame) buildouts across California — telecom closets on each floor or wing that home-run horizontal cabling for a floor plate and connect back to the MDF over the backbone. Access Cabling installs racks, patch panels, backbone terminations, PoE switching, grounding, and full documentation.

What belongs in an IDF

Wall-mount or floor-standing rack, patch panels for horizontal cabling (typically 24 or 48 port CAT6/6A per panel), fiber cross-connect from the MDF backbone (12-24 strand OS2), access-layer PoE switching, UPS for switch and phone survival through short outages, cable management (horizontal and vertical), and grounding bar bonded to the telecom bonding backbone from the MDF.

Power and grounding

Dedicated 20A circuit minimum, UPS on the rack sized for switch survival through utility blips (10-30 min typical), PDU at rack, and grounding bar bonded to the TBB from the MDF per TIA-607-D.

Can existing cable be reused during a IDF Buildouts refresh in Bakersfield?+

Sometimes. On Bakersfield refresh projects we Fluke-test the existing plant first: if runs pass CAT6 or CAT6A channel spec and pathways are clean, they stay. Anything failing certification, abandoned per NEC 800.25, or unlabeled gets removed and replaced. You get a channel-by-channel keep/replace decision — not a blanket rip-and-replace bill.

How long does a typical IDF Buildouts project take in Bakersfield?+

Timelines depend on drop count, pathway complexity, and after-hours restrictions. A small Bakersfield tenant improvement of 20–40 drops usually completes in 2–5 working days. Larger Kern County projects with backbone fiber, MDF/IDF buildouts, and multiple floors typically run 2–6 weeks. Do IDFs need cooling?+

Depends on equipment load. Small IDFs (one PoE switch, one UPS) usually run fine on general building HVAC with a return-air grill. Larger IDFs or high-density PoE need dedicated cooling — mini-split or duct-in supply.

How is grounding handled?+

Grounding bar in the IDF bonded to the telecom bonding backbone (TBB) from the MDF with #6 AWG minimum. Every rack bonded to the grounding bar. TIA-607-D compliant.
